As a Brit, a lot of the nouns for food are really quite familiar from 'Indian' restaurants (which tend to be run by Bengalis and not Indians here in the UK), but there seems to be a vocabulary continuum going on as so many of the words are familiar (piaz - onion, samsa - samosa, shashlik - well, erm, shaslik, plov - pilaf).

Osh- plove- rice dish Osh bolsin - enjoy your meal, bon appetit in Uzbek))) when chefs or guys told him “osh bolsin” , Trevor thought they’re referring to plove.
